This March 8 & 9, Alzheimers Coachella Valley (ACV) and National Charity League, Coachella Valley Chapter (NCLCV) will host “Vintage Prep”, a two-day pop-up shop of curated, pre-owned fashion at The River Rancho Mirage.
As a former member of NCLCV, ACV Programs Director and NCLCV Sustainers Group President, Priscilla Kubas, helped run a bi-annual rummage sale to raise scholarship funds for local high school girls who were planning to attend College of the Desert after finishing High School. After a hiatus of over seven years, and a visit to some amazing thrift shops in Vienna, Austria, Priscilla decided to re-visit the concept, but in a more thoughtful and youthful way. In partnership with The River Rancho Mirage, “Vintage Prep” will offer a highly curated offering of pre-owned clothing, jewelry, and accessories with a classic ‘preppy’ aesthetic. About National Charity League, Coachella Valley Chapter and Alzheimers Coachella Valley
NCLCV is a Mother-Daughter service and leadership program established in the Palm Desert area over 50 years ago. In 2020, NCLCV added ACV to its list of designated philanthropies, and, since then, has assisted ACV with its mission of providing free support services, education, and counseling to families in the Coachella Valley living with dementia.
